Otc Login

The **Otc Login** page is your gateway to ordering free or discounted health items. These can include vitamins, pain relievers, first aid supplies, and more. Each plan has a specific quarterly allowance.

To start, you need your member ID and a password. Most providers use the same ID from your main insurance card. If you forgot your password, the reset option is usually on the login screen.

Step-By-Step Login Instructions

  1. Go to your insurance plan’s OTC website. This is often listed on your member card.
  2. Click the “Login” or “Member Login” button. It is usually in the top right corner.
  3. Enter your username. This is often your member ID number.
  4. Type in your password. If this is your first time, look for a “Register” link.
  5. Click “Sign In” or “Submit”. You should now see your dashboard.

What You Can Do After Logging In

Once you are inside the portal, you have several options. The main page shows your current balance. This is the amount you can spend this quarter.

  • Check Your Balance: See how much money you have left to spend.
  • Place an Order: Browse the catalog and add items to your cart.
  • View Order History: See what you ordered in the past.
  • Update Your Profile: Change your address or contact info.

Orders are usually shipped for free. They arrive in 7 to 10 business days. You can order online or by phone if you prefer.

Common Login Issues And Fixes

Sometimes you might have trouble logging in. Here are the most common problems and how to fix them.

Forgotten Password

Click the “Forgot Password” link. You will need to enter your member ID and date of birth. A reset link will be sent to your email on file.

Account Locked

After too many failed attempts, your account may lock. Wait 15 minutes and try again. If it stays locked, call the customer service number on your card.

Wrong Website

Make sure you are on the correct site. Some plans use a third-party vendor like OTC Health Solutions or NationsBenefits. Double check the URL.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Is My Username For Otc Login?

Your username is usually your member ID number. This is found on your insurance card. Some plans use your email address instead.

Can I Use Otc Login On My Phone?

Yes. Most OTC portals are mobile-friendly. You can log in from your phone or tablet. Some providers also have a dedicated app.

Why Is My Otc Login Not Working?

Check your internet connection first. Then make sure you are using the correct member ID. If you are still stuck, clear your browser cache or try a different browser.

How Often Can I Place An Order?

Most plans allow one order per month. Your quarterly balance resets every three months. Unused funds do not roll over.

What Items Are Eligible For My OTC Benefit?

Eligible items include vitamins, cold medicine, pain relievers, and first aid supplies. Prescription drugs are not included. The catalog inside the portal shows all approved items.
